Valspar Championship (Day Two)
Only Reed gives us hope for the weekend, four behind the leaders, MacKenzie & Stricker in an open contest with the field bunched. Speith hit a 68 to make the weekend but several big names are going home (Kaymer, Bradley, McDowell, Simpson & Els)
Patrick Reed 30/1 -1 Tied 15th
Harris English 35/1 MC
Kevin Streelman 66/1 MC
John Senden 125/1 MC
Harold Varner III 250/1 MC
